I don't know if anyone has had to sit with a new prospect and go over the Sage naming conventions (100, 300, 500) but I did today.
Talk about confusing.
First, prospect assumes (not unreasonably) Sage 100 is entry level.
Second, they asks - ""so we can seamlessly convert and upgrade to 300 or 500 as we grow"".
I'm a believer that in these instances it may be better to bring up this issue rather than wait for the prospect to ask.
If I were out for an easy sales commission I could have just misled the prospect into thinking these were all related products with a seamless transition as the company grew...
